Morgan Stanley Wealth Management Financial Advisors can conduct their business in several ways: individually, as a member of a team of Financial Advisors, or through the formation of a Strategic Partnership with another Financial Advisor or team of Financial Advisors. A Strategic Partnership is an arrangement between a Financial Advisor or a team of Financial Advisors with another Financial Advisor or team of Financial Advisors that has a unique focus or knowledge regarding a specific business concentration, product area, and/or client type. If your account is with an individual Financial Advisor, that Financial Advisor services all facets of your account. If your account is with a Financial Advisor who is a member of a team, any Financial Advisor on the team can service your account. If your Financial Advisor is part of a Strategic Partnership, his or her role in that Strategic Partnership may be limited to a specific business and/or product area and may not cover all facets of your account. 1Investors should consider many factors before deciding which 529 plan is appropriate. Some of these factors include: the Plan's investment options and the historical investment performance of these options, the Plan's flexibility and features, the reputation and expertise of the Plan's investment manager, Plan contribution limits and the federal and state tax benefits associated with an investment in the Plan. Some states, for example, offer favorable tax treatment and other benefits to their residents only if they invest in the state's own Qualified Tuition Program. Investors should determine their home state's tax treatment of 529 plans when considering whether to choose an in-state or out-of-state plan. Important Risk Information for Securities Based Lending: Clients must be aware that: (1) Sufficient collateral must be maintained to support the loan and to take future advances; (2) Clients may have to deposit additional cash or eligible securities on short notice; (3) Some or all of the pledged securities may be sold without prior notice in order to maintain account equity at required collateral maintenance levels. Clients will not be entitled to choose the securities that will be sold. These actions may interrupt long-term investment strategy and may result in adverse tax consequences or in additional fees being assessed; (4) Morgan Stanley Bank, N.A., Morgan Stanley Private Bank, National Association or Morgan Stanley Smith Barney LLC (collectively referred to as "Morgan Stanley") reserve the right not to fund any advance request due to insufficient collateral or for any other reason except for any portion of a securities based loan that is identified as a committed facility; (5) Morgan Stanley reserves the right to increase the collateral maintenance requirements at any time without notice; and (6) Morgan Stanley reserves the right to call securities based loans at any time and for any reason.

With the exception of a margin loan, the proceeds from securities based loan products may not be used to purchase, trade, or carry margin stock (or securities, with respect to Express CreditLine); repay margin debt that was used to purchase, trade or carry margin stock (or securities, with respect to Express CreditLine); and cannot be deposited into a Morgan Stanley Smith Barney LLC or other brokerage account.

To be eligible for a securities based loan, a client must have a brokerage account at Morgan Stanley Smith Barney LLC that contains eligible securities, which shall serve as collateral for the securities based loan.
